While Cairns may not be a culinary capital, we found some decent options among the limited choices: ๐ซ Skip This: Salt & Pepper Squid - Mediocre at best, not worth ordering. ๐ Worth Trying: T-Bone Steak - Cooked well, but the real star is the Peri Peri sauce that takes it to another level! Prawn Linguine - Surprisingly better than the version at Villa Romana (who knew?). ๐ถ๏ธ Thai Gem: Iyara by Sakare delivers solid Thai flavors! Their Goong Pad Num Prik Poaw (stir-fried prawns in roasted chili paste) is a standout - the rich, fragrant sauce pairs perfectly with coconut rice. A rare bright spot in Cairns' dining scene! Final Verdict: Manage your expectations, but decent meals can be found if you order strategically.
